Description & Technical information
Designed and executed: Austro-Hungarian Monarchy, around 1905
Solid oak, 105 panes of faceted and cut glass mounted
in brass, glass shelves, with nickel-plated brass holders, brass fittings, small wooden parts repaired, surface slightly repolished, very good condition
First-class cabinet making
Date: around 1905
Origin: Austrian
Medium: Solid oak
Dimensions: 141 x 138 x 68 cm (55¹/₂ x 54³/₈ x 26³/₄ inches)
Provenance: private property, Austria
